电子设计工程
電子設計工程
전자설계공정
ELECTRONIC DESIGN ENGINEERING
2012年
14期
50-52,55
,共4页
MATLAB%动态链接库%硬件访问%数据采集
MATLAB%動態鏈接庫%硬件訪問%數據採集
MATLAB%동태련접고%경건방문%수거채집
MATLAB%dynamic linkable library%access to hardware%data acquisition
MATLAB是一款高性能的科学与工程计算软件,具有强大的数值计算和分析能力,但其对硬件的访问能力较弱。在MATLAB环境中实现对硬件资源的直接访问可以极大的方便对数据的处理及算法的验证,基于这种目的提出一种扩展MATLAB访问硬件的方法,通过MATLAB外部函数接口调用第三方器件商提供的动态链接库导出函数,在MATLAB平台下实现对一般硬件的访问,并具体介绍了该方法在气压高度计原型系统设计中的应用。该方法简化了MATLAB与硬件的数据交互,对于原型系统设计和算法的验证提供了一种有效的手段。
MATLAB是一款高性能的科學與工程計算軟件,具有彊大的數值計算和分析能力,但其對硬件的訪問能力較弱。在MATLAB環境中實現對硬件資源的直接訪問可以極大的方便對數據的處理及算法的驗證,基于這種目的提齣一種擴展MATLAB訪問硬件的方法,通過MATLAB外部函數接口調用第三方器件商提供的動態鏈接庫導齣函數,在MATLAB平檯下實現對一般硬件的訪問,併具體介紹瞭該方法在氣壓高度計原型繫統設計中的應用。該方法簡化瞭MATLAB與硬件的數據交互,對于原型繫統設計和算法的驗證提供瞭一種有效的手段。
MATLAB시일관고성능적과학여공정계산연건,구유강대적수치계산화분석능력,단기대경건적방문능력교약。재MATLAB배경중실현대경건자원적직접방문가이겁대적방편대수거적처리급산법적험증,기우저충목적제출일충확전MATLAB방문경건적방법,통과MATLAB외부함수접구조용제삼방기건상제공적동태련접고도출함수,재MATLAB평태하실현대일반경건적방문,병구체개소료해방법재기압고도계원형계통설계중적응용。해방법간화료MATLAB여경건적수거교호,대우원형계통설계화산법적험증제공료일충유효적수단。
MATLAB is a high-performance scientific and engineering computing software with a strong numerical calculation and analysis capabilities,but its ability to access the hardware is weak.In the MATLAB environment direct access to hardware resources can greatly facilitate the validation of data processing and algorithm,based on this purpose propose an extension of MATLAB hardware access,using MATLAB external interface functions to call third-party devices’ dynamic link library exported functions realize the general hardware access,and specific description of the method in the barometric altimeter prototype system design.This approach simplifies the MATLAB and hardware data exchange,provides an effective means for the prototype system design and validation of the algorithm.